The General Rules:<br />
Without going into a great amount of detail, the rules are pretty simple—the Emperor starts with two Custodes and as he explores the ship, they can find other trapped Custodes to aid the fight. However, given they are on quite possibly the most evil Astartes ship in existence—they are also bound to find some Daemons along the way. As the Chaos player, I rolled on my little chart and made some random Warp Points—along with some random trapped Custodes. Depending on that roll, I might get a couple of Bloodletters—Flamers—or perhaps a Herald. Once the Emperor or any Custodes approached or opened a door into that room/point, I rolled on the chart. The fire burning behind the stained glass in the building...is actually individual wreck markers I can remove when my vehicles blow up (Turned off, they simulate me popping smoke, turned on...well the rhino is dead!);<br /><br /><br /><a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EhZBdEUb_Bb-cFenPShPuJTaYU-APiAaAWuarmX-6KTQsd2FCu3-0iIFzswlv5BjIThwK_yfJo5VpTSkLFaeGCCMorKIAVU1rAsbfcCc3w0KD-Qq2JfRGtl1Zr6X7_KscO7WkbwS7hxyjU/s1600/WreckMarkers.jpg"><img style="display: block; margin: 0px auto 10px; text-align: center; cursor: pointer; width: 400px; height: 300px;"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EhZBdEUb_Bb-cFenPShPuJTaYU-APiAaAWuarmX-6KTQsd2FCu3-0iIFzswlv5BjIThwK_yfJo5VpTSkLFaeGCCMorKIAVU1rAsbfcCc3w0KD-Qq2JfRGtl1Zr6X7_KscO7WkbwS7hxyjU/s400/WreckMarkers.jpg" alt="" id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5452276920748064050" border="0" /></a><br /><br /><br />The display itself is a picture frame with MDF mounted via velcro. So after Adepticon I can pop this display out and put it on my cityfight board...then next year make another display and 'pop' that new one in. We will do what ever to assist in denying the Humans access to the weapon.” ....."</span></span><br /><br /><br /><br />The Last Stand Special Scenario<br /><br />The Last Stand Scenario incorporates many special rules found over the following pages.<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Sewers</span><br />The battle for the city has been raging in the air, on the ground and now even below the ground. There are various sewer entrances scattered on the board (marked by specialized terrain). You may ‘embark’ in a sewer entrance during your turn by moving/running within 2 inches of it. That unit is now removed from the board and may be placed within 2 inches of any other sewer entrance on the board the following turn following the rules for disembarking (Counts as moving, may not be placed within 1 inch of an enemy). However, if the enemy has the entrance you wish to disembark from surrounded (within 1 inch) you may not use that exit.<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Spread too thin...</span><br />The defense of the city with such a small force has left very few units defending entire blocks. To represent this, the defenders MUST place at least 1/3 of their units in strategic reserve.<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Teleport Housing/Device</span><br />One of the buildings of the city houses a teleport device which is a smaller, less powerful version present on Imperial ships. If your side controls this building, any friendly infantry unit not engaged in close combat and within 12 inches of the building may be removed from the board. This unit will immediately deep strike to any area of the players choosing that is within 48 inches of the building. This happens at the start of the movement phase and only one unit is allowed to use it per turn. The teleportation follows all of the rules for Deep Strike with one exception; if double 1’s are rolled for scatter, the unit is lost!<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Radar Array</span><br />A small communication building with a powerful radar array is located within the city. The army that controls this tower is able to send a powerful signal through the various jamming present in the sector with coordinates for an orbital bombardment. The bombardment is a Str. 8 AP 3, 5 inch blast that follows all rules for ordinance. If the bombardment scatters, the ballistic skill is considered 2 when reducing scatter.<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Sustained Assault</span><br />The two Chapters have been battered back deeper and deeper into the bowels of the city desperately attempting to buy time. However, there is no room left to retreat, it’s now defend or die! The Eldar/Tau alliances know this as well and are therefore committing every last reserve to the fight. At the start of their turn, the Eldar/Tau players may remove any Troop choice that is 25% or below from the table. On their next turn, this unit will come on from any of their board edges at full strength. Any dedicated transport vehicles not immobilized are also removed from the table but retain any damage they had previously when redeploying the next turn. If the transport is immobilized, the infantry unit removed must hoof it the following turn!<br /><br />In addition, each player on the Tau/Eldar team may nominate one unit that is not normally considered a troop and make it such. This unit also benefits from the Sustained Assault special rule!<br /><br /><br /><br /><br />Scenarios Steps:<br /><br />1. Setup Terrain<br />2. Here we go;<br /><br />Strengths of the codex:<br /><br />HQ:<br />Heavy VC Hive Tyrant w/ Tyrant Guard<br />Tervigons<br />Alpha Warrior<br /><br />Elite:<br />Hive Guard<br />Zoanthropes<br />Ymgarl Genestealers<br /><br />Troops:<br />Death Spitter Warriors<br />Termagaunts<br /><br />Heavy:<br />Trygon/Mawlocs<br /><br /><br />Here is why I think the above:<br /><br />Tervigons: Make 3d6 Gaunts each turn (yeah really), synapse range of 18" with Ld. 10. Grants special powers to nearby gaunts/units (Like FNP!), 6 wounds with T6...and he's cheaper than a squad of marines. Expect to see this...a lot.<br /><br />Alpha Warrior: Better than a SM Captain at a cheaper cost, has access to very cheap upgrades...and can lead any unit. Gaunts with FNP, Furious Charge and this guy leading the bunch. Natural T5 too with multi-wound stat line, so piss off Power Fist. Expect to see this guy leading Gaunts near you.<br /><br />Hive Guard: The answer to transports for Nids. Str. 8 Weapons that don't need line of sight and decent range....on a T6, multi-wound, cover save getting (yeah infantry class, so gaunts give them cover) chassis. Oh and BS 4. So a unit of 3 puts out 6 Str. 8 shots to pop rhinos.<br /><br />Zoanthropes: I think (I'll need to do the math on this) that their Str. 10 Lance AP1 shots are better at popping tanks than melta in double dice range. Again, BS 4. Oh and they have a 3++ and can ride in pods. What Land Raider? :)<br /><br />Ymgarl Genestealers: They have the rules the Lictors should have (No scatter DS, move AND assault the turn they come in. Stealers still beat face and this stealer species has 4+ saves... so this could be a fun unit...but the elite section has a lot of competition. Still a good unit.<br /><br />Death Spitter Warriors: Good fire-base (A max unit will put out 27 Str. 5 shots!) and they score. They die pretty damn easy losing eternal warrior...but if they are shooting their Warriors with that kind of weaponry the rest of your monsters are safe. Put them in cover, squat and shoot.<br /><br />Termagaunts: Stealers die too easy now with a 5+ and spike rifles can be decent.<br /><br />Trygon: Beat stick and deep strikes. You get a turn to shoot it before it starts eating your army (that your Hive Guard just popped out of their metal boxes). He scares my marines.<br /><br />Mawloc: Pops up like the Trygon then vomits a St. 6 AP2 large blast on you. Oh, he's not much weaker than the Trygon in HTH. And can reburrow to do it again. And has Hit and Run. And is the same cost as a Carnifex. Yeah really.<br /><br /><br />So there are the units that jump out at me.
